WebChelsea Vowel is Métis from manitow-sâkahikan (Lac Ste. Anne) Alberta where she and her family currently reside. She has a BEd and LLB and is mother to three girls, step-mother of two more. Chelsea is a public intellectual, writer and educator whose work intersects language, gender, Métis self-determination and resurgence. WebListen to Chelsea Vowel on Spotify. Connect Now Writing Services Online Courses Order Now Services Menu Assignment Assignment Academic Writing Services Academic Writing Services Assignment Help … WebChapter Four of Chelsea Vowel’s “Indigenous Writes: A Guide to First Nations, Métis, & Inuit Issues in Canada” discusses interesting complexities of defining Métis identity. She identifies two main approaches to defining Métis identity: the “little m” and “big M ” definitions. The first rests on the direct translation of métis (mixed), and refers to one’s …
